I took possession of our new home on a hot autumn day only to discover the original air conditioner already broken (literally, a great "house warming" gift). After being referred to Rawlings HVAC by our home warranty company (and not knowing anyone in the area), I called Derek Rawlings and he was able to come out just a couple days later. He came by my house to check out the problem, spotted rotted wiring right away and set me up to replace the system with a Comfortmaker heating and cooling system. He was able to order the parts and do the work the next day. Generally speaking, the prompt servicing stopped there. When running the air conditioning for the first time, Derek noticed the fan blowing at, what seemed to me, twice the normal power. It was very loud but, after having lived in Hawaii for over three years with no A/C or heating, I could not remember how it was supposed to sound. Derek assured me it was normal and give it time to kick in and get started. The next day, Derek called me and asked to stop back over to adjust some settings (I think he did some more research and realized the fan was NOT supposed to blow so hard). He came the next day and the fan was adjusted properly. He then told me that I would probably have to have the settings adjusted again when it came time to turn the heat on (why didn't he just do it then, I'll never know). Around the beginning of December, it was time to turn the heat on so I tried the system out and sure enough the fan was blowing too hard. I called Derek, he said he'd be able to come out, we set up a date and he never showed up. I asked what happened and he said he forgot. He said he'd call back to let me know when he could come out, he never called, I called him back and he didn't pick up. I texted him (he often communicated this way- which totally bugs me), he said he'd let me know and then never did. Finally, I emailed him letting him know that I had family coming to stay and did not want them sleeping in a room that was freezing and then roasting because of the messed up settings. Finally, after almost two weeks, he came out and in about 5 minutes adjusted the settings. I gave him a Christmas card with a $30 tip for making the trip out. When the time came around to turn the A/C on LESS THAN A YEAR AFTER THE NEW ONE WAS INSTALLED, I got another surprise-- the touch screen Comfortmaker thermostat was blank, I couldn't even reset it to get to a home screen or anything. I called Derek to see if he could troubleshoot and, of course, it took several calls and missed appointments for me to finally be told he had a family emergency and couldn't make it out that week. Fed up and sweating (again), I went to my neighbor, Stu, who works for a commercial A/C company who advised me to check the wiring and get a new thermostat. He talked me through the process and I went to Home Depot and bought a Honeywell touch screen thermostat, installed it in a few minutes and the A/C was up and running. I will never call Derek again.
Description of Work: Replaced heating and cooling system in our 1700 sq ft home and installed a new thermostat.
